Zombie Night Terror is a strategy-puzzle game that significantly challenges cognitive skills. Players must employ problem-solving, strategic thinking, and adaptive challenge to guide their zombie horde through intricate levels, utilizing unique mutations and combo systems to overcome obstacles. It fosters creativity in finding solutions and enhances learning transfer as players adapt strategies to increasingly complex scenarios.

The primary risks in Zombie Night Terror stem from its mature content. The game features frequent and intense cartoon violence, gore, and strong horror themes centered around a zombie apocalypse. Players control the zombies, actively participating in the extermination of humanity. However, the game is free from manipulative compulsion-loop mechanics, aggressive monetization, or social risks, making its engagement driven by gameplay rather than exploitative design.
